Working memory refers to a combination of components, including short-term memory and attention, that allow an individual to hold information temporarily as we perform cognitive tasks. It is an essential cognitive function that enables the execution of complex tasks such as problem-solving, comprehension, and reasoning. 内容独立指针为视觉和语言刺激提供工作记忆存储.

Woohyeuk Chang1, Will Epstein2, Henry Jones1

  • 1University of Chicago.

Journal of cognitive neuroscience
|March 4, 2026
PubMed
概括

工作内存 (WM) 存储可能使用一般机制,而不是不同的缓冲器. 这项研究表明,EEG中的内容独立的"指针"信号在视觉和语言任务中跟踪项目号码.

科学领域:

  • 认知神经科学 认知神经科学
  • 心理学 心理学 心理学

背景情况:

  • 突出的工作记忆 (WM) 模型提出了不同的视觉和语言存储缓冲器.
  • 行为和神经研究支持视觉和语言WM存储之间的差异.
  • 最近的研究表明,一个独立于内容的域-通用WM存储签名.

研究的目的:

  • 调查内容独立的神经信号是否反映出一般的WM存储机制.
  • 为了测试这个假设,这个信号代表了一个"指针"操作的上下文绑定.
  • 要确定这个指针信号是否在不同的刺激类型 (视觉,语言,连接) 中进行概括.

主要方法:

  • 三个数据集的分析,包括重新分析的已发表的数据和两个新的EEG实验.
  • 应用多变量EEG模式分析来追踪神经活动.
  • 通过视觉 (颜色),语言 (字母/单词) 和组合刺激 (彩色单词) 进行EEG模式的比较.

主要成果:

  • 多变量EEG模式始终跟踪项目数量,无论刺激类型 (视觉,口头或组合).
  • 确定了一个强大的,内容独立的负载信号,在感知格式和刺激变化中稳定.
  • 这个信号与与空间注意力和认知努力相关的神经活动分离.

结论:

  • 这些发现支持一种独立于内容的神经机制来跟踪工作记忆中的项目数量.
  • 有证据表明",指针"信号在各种模式中概括,支持上下文绑定.
  • 在工作内存中的项目数量索引和功能维护之间存在分离.
